This time I started by ink blending a background in rainbow colors with the new MSTN Classic Edges Stencil and following Premium Dye Inks: Wild Cherry, Moroccan Spice, Orange Zest, Candied Yam, Butterscotch, Lemon Drop, Sour Apple, Summer Splash, Cornflower and Grape Jelly. I used the grid of the cutting mat as a guide, to place the stencil for each color and it worked perfectly.

Next, I stamped some of the words, letters and numbers from the Hip Hip Yay Day, Hip Hip Yay Alphabet and Hip Hip Yay Numbers on Heavyweight Translucent Vellum. Although you can’t really tell from the pictures, I also used clear embossing powder for some shine and volume…

Once I cut my panel and all of the elements, I could plan the exact placement of them and use Prismacolor pencils to color the inside of them to match the background..

As a last touch, I added some matching enamel dots and hearts. Check out what my talented teammates made with today’s featured products and head on to the My Favorite Things YouTube Channel for more inspiration.
